Ryan Roy

Director of Technology, Modeling & Analytics, Western Power Pool

Wenatchee, WA

Ryan Roy is the Director of Technology, Modeling and Analytics at the Western Power Pool (WPP) and is responsible for establishing strategic direction related to the use of information technology, modeling, and analytics in support of WPP reliability programs.

Mr. Roy acts as the primary subject matter expert on scheduling, trading, BAA / merchant operations issues and hydro modeling for the Western Resource Adequacy Program (WRAP), Pacific Northwest Coordination Agreement (PNCA) and the Reserve Sharing Group (RSG).

Prior to joining WPP in 2021, Mr. Roy spent 18 years working in public power most recently as the Manager of Short-Term Trading and Operations at Chelan County Public Utility District.  In his role at Chelan PUD, he was responsible for the day-ahead trading function and management and optimization of Chelan’s hydro generating resources. 

Mr. Roy earned a Master of Science degree in Software Engineering from DePaul University, and bachelor’s degrees in Business Administration and Computer Science.
